aboutsummaryrefslogtreecommitdiffstats
path: root/lib/snmp/mibs/SNMPv2-MIB.funcs
diff options
context:
space:
mode:
Diffstat (limited to 'lib/snmp/mibs/SNMPv2-MIB.funcs')
-rw-r--r--lib/snmp/mibs/SNMPv2-MIB.funcs28
1 files changed, 28 insertions, 0 deletions
diff --git a/lib/snmp/mibs/SNMPv2-MIB.funcs b/lib/snmp/mibs/SNMPv2-MIB.funcs
new file mode 100644
index 0000000000..8fe25bb477
--- /dev/null
+++ b/lib/snmp/mibs/SNMPv2-MIB.funcs
@@ -0,0 +1,28 @@
+%% The system group
+{sysUpTime, {snmp_standard_mib, sys_up_time, []}}.
+{sysDescr, {snmp_generic, variable_func, [{sysDescr, permanent}]}}.
+{sysObjectID, {snmp_generic, variable_func, [{sysObjectID, permanent}]}}.
+{sysContact, {snmp_generic, variable_func, [{sysContact, permanent}]}}.
+{sysName, {snmp_generic, variable_func, [{sysName, permanent}]}}.
+{sysLocation, {snmp_generic, variable_func, [{sysLocation, permanent}]}}.
+{sysServices, {snmp_generic, variable_func, [{sysServices, permanent}]}}.
+
+{sysORLastChange, {snmp_generic, variable_func, [{sysORLastChange, volatile}]}}.
+{sysORTable, {snmp_standard_mib, sys_or_table, []}}.
+
+%% Snmp special objects
+{snmpEnableAuthenTraps, {snmp_standard_mib, snmp_enable_authen_traps, []}}.
+{snmpSetSerialNo, {snmp_standard_mib, snmp_set_serial_no, []}}.
+
+%% Counters
+{snmpInPkts, {snmp_standard_mib, variable_func, [snmpInPkts]}}.
+{snmpInBadVersions, {snmp_standard_mib, variable_func, [snmpInBadVersions]}}.
+{snmpInBadCommunityNames, {snmp_standard_mib, variable_func, [snmpInBadCommunityNames]}}.
+{snmpInBadCommunityUses, {snmp_standard_mib, variable_func, [snmpInBadCommunityUses]}}.
+{snmpInASNParseErrs, {snmp_standard_mib, variable_func, [snmpInASNParseErrs]}}.
+{snmpProxyDrops, {snmp_standard_mib, variable_func, [snmpProxyDrops]}}.
+{snmpSilentDrops, {snmp_standard_mib, variable_func, [snmpSilentDrops]}}.
+
+%% Dummy objects, included in notifications
+{snmpTrapEnterprise, {snmp_standard_mib, dummy, []}}.
+{snmpTrapOID, {snmp_standard_mib, dummy, []}}.